I had battery changed, by people that i thought new how to do it. door locks, locks and unlocks when driving, Radio turns on and off at same time. What happened? How do i fix it?

Check the battery connections are good, that the terminal ends aren't frayed or loose. From your description your car may be losing electrical power intermittently while driving. If you can't solve this yourself get it to a reliable shop or garage and ask them to check over the battery connections.
